About Fernando Chierchie

Fernando Chierchie is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Biomedical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, Nuclear and High Energy Physics and Instrumentation, having authored 53 papers that have together received 289 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include CCD and CMOS Imaging Sensors (28 papers), Infrared Target Detection Methodologies (15 papers), Advanced Power Amplifier Design (12 papers), Radio Frequency Integrated Circuit Design (12 papers), Particle Detector Development and Performance (11 papers), Advancements in PLL and VCO Technologies (9 papers), Analog and Mixed-Signal Circuit Design (8 papers) and Photocathodes and Microchannel Plates (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electrical and Electronic Engineering (275 citations), Instrumentation (14 citations), Nuclear and High Energy Physics (42 citations), Biomedical Engineering (73 citations) and Aerospace Engineering (41 citations). Fernando Chierchie has collaborated with scholars based in Argentina, United States and Paraguay. Frequent co-authors include Eduardo E. Paolini, Leandro Stefanazzi, Alejandro Oliva, Pablo S. Mandolesi, Guillermo Fernández Moroni, Juan Estrada, Javier Tiffenberg, Gustavo Cancelo, Sven Ole Aase and Miguel Sofo Haro.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Circuits and Systems I Regular Papers, International Journal of Circuit Theory and Applications, IEEE Transactions on Circuits & Systems II Express Briefs, Journal of Astronomical Telescopes Instruments and Systems and IEEE Transactions on Instrumentation and Measurement.
